SOUTH BEND, Ind. – South Bend Police are investigating a shooting that happened in the 600 block of Sheridan Street after 9:00 a.m. Saturday morning.
The victim is an 18-year-old male with a wound to the back. He is being treated at the hospital for non life-threatening injuries.
There is also an alleged second victim in the shooting.
Officers did not locate anyone after searching extensively.
No walk-in injuries have been reported at local and area hospitals.
Police were also responding to a report of an alleged robbery after shots were fired in the area of Kayley Street and Western Avenue.
It is unknown if the two incidents are related.
Both cases are currently under investigation.
